Abstract
A power generating bearing assembly (100) comprising a bearing (120) retained by a bearing housing (110). The bearing housing (110) includes a bearing cooling passage system comprising at least one integrated liquid cooling passage (130) is integrated within the bearing housing (110). A turbine receiving bore (160) is formed through the bearing housing (110), penetrating the integrated liquid cooling segment (130). A turbine assembly (200) is inserted into the turbine receiving bore (160), positioning a turbine blade subassembly (230) of the turbine assembly (200) within the integrated liquid cooling passage (130), wherein fluid flowing within the integrated liquid cooling passage (130) causes the blade subassembly (230) to rotate. The rotation of the blade subassembly (230) rotates an electric power generator (collectively 222, 224, 226, 240, 242, 244, 246) to create electric power.
